The Best Dog Parks in Charlottesville, VA

Dogs adore the exhilarating natural aura of dog parks, exploring trails, running free, and interacting with other canines. This helps maintain their social, mental, and physical well-being. 

Luckily, Charlottesville is ‘packed’ with dog parks to unleash your friendly pup. Here are some of the best options:

1. Chris Greene Lake Park

Chris Greene Lake Park is a 239-acre park that’s a few minutes from Charlottesville Airport. While there are tons of recreational amenities for virtually anyone, dog lovers will especially appreciate the dog park. It’s a 1-acre fenced area—complete with water access—for your furry friend to let loose on the ground or water.

Address: 4748 Chris Greene Lake Road; Charlottesville, VA 22911

2. Azalea Dog Park

Azalea Dog Park is an immaculate and fenced off-leash park in the larger 23-acre Azalea Park. It offers a great opportunity for you and your dog to explore and interact with like-minded individuals (whether human or canine). It’s mostly grassy and well-maintained with plenty of poop bags to facilitate an enjoyable experience.

Address: 304 Old Lynchburg Rd; Charlottesville, VA 22903

3. Darden-Towe Dog Park

Darden-Towe Dog Park is a popular destination for dog owners, and for good reason. It’s spacious enough to give your dog some freedom of movement, there’s a doggie water fountain, a friendly crowd, and picnic tables for you. 

The off-leash area is located on the side of a hill—so expect a good workout.
PS: Remember to bring along your own poop bag to clean up after your pooch. And ensure your dog is up-to-date with vaccinations and licenses.

Address: Darden Towe Park and Elk Dr; Charlottesville, VA

Locally-Owned Pet Stores in Charlottesville, VA

Having outdoor fun with your doggo is one thing; loading up on the essentials to take care of their everyday needs in a whole ‘nother beast. You need a reliable pet store that guarantees satisfaction—both for you and for your pet. If you live around Charlottesville, here are the best locally-owned pet stores to source your supplies:

1. Natural Pet Essentials

Natural Pet Supplies is a store founded by a long-time dog lover for dog lovers. They deal in various kinds of all-natural pet food from approved brands, supplements to enhance your pet’s health, treats, quality grooming essentials, gifts for fellow pet lovers, and a decent collection of toys.

You can also grab pet care items like car seats, diapers, travel gear, training aids, and backpacks. The only downside is a less-than-appealing website and online shop.

Address: 3440 Seminole Trail Suite 105/106; Charlottesville, VA 22911 – (434) 979-9779

2. Pet Food Discounters

If you’re looking for an affordable locally-owned pet store in Charlottesville, Pet Food Discounters is your best bet. To quote their website, Pet Food Discounters is “Locally owned and operated for over 30 years…”

And as their brand name implies, they offer a wide variety of products for all your pets at competitive prices. They even have a dedicated “Special Offers” section in their online store for pet owners who can’t resist a good discount on quality products.

Address: 607 Woodbrook Drive; Charlottesville, VA 22901 – (434) 974-6060

3. Pet Supplies Plus

Pet Supplies Plus is a one-stop-shop for all your pet care needs. The independently owned and operated store deals in everything from foods, edible chews, grooming kits, pest control, apparel, to toys for dogs, kitties, fish, reptiles, and small pets. But what really sets them apart from their crowd is their add-on services such as wellness checks, baths, teeth brushing, and other luxurious grooming offers.

Address: 1240 Seminole Trl; Charlottesville, VA 22901 – (434) 979-2009
